About:

Prior to law school, Bryan was a project manager for a healthcare contract service provider. Creating in-house programs relating to patient logistics, Bryan managed hundreds of employees, balanced many budgets, and learned first-hand the power of contractual law. It was here that Bryan discovered his two passions: people and the law. Bryan began his legal career as a family law attorney in Fort Worth. After handling everything from basic custody agreements to high-asset divorces, Bryan accepted an opportunity to be a trial attorney at the Montgomery County District Attorney’s Office. As a Felony Prosecutor, Bryan tried dozens of cases, worked with many County and District Court Judges, and gained valuable experience as to the inner-workings of our judicial system. It was from this experience that Bryan developed the excellent perspective for how the law can be used to benefit those people in need.
